Common Questions
What's the most common sign of a sprinkler leak in my Waco yard, and how quickly should I get it fixed?
In Waco's climate, the most obvious signs are soggy patches or unusually green, fast-growing grass in one spot while the rest of the lawn struggles. You might also see a spike in your water bill. We recommend addressing leaks promptly—within a week if possible. Even a small leak can waste hundreds of gallons in our Texas heat, stressing your lawn's overall health and costing you money.
How does Fat Boyz Landscaping fix compacted soil, and why is it a problem in our area?
Waco's clay-heavy soil is prone to compaction from foot traffic and weather, preventing water, air, and nutrients from reaching grass roots. We use core aeration, which removes small plugs of soil to relieve compaction. This allows for better water absorption during downpours and deeper root growth, making your lawn more drought-resistant and healthier overall, which is key for our local conditions.
Can you handle both sprinkler repair and aeration, and is there a best time of year for these services in Central Texas?
Absolutely, we routinely handle both as part of a complete lawn health plan. For sprinkler repairs, anytime you notice a problem is the right time to call—leaks don't wait. For core aeration, the ideal windows in Waco are early spring (March-April) or early fall (September-October). This timing gives grass roots the perfect opportunity to grow into the newly opened soil before the summer heat or winter dormancy sets in.
